How to Reset Your AeroGarden: A Step-by-Step Guide
The exact process for resetting your AeroGarden may vary slightly depending on the model you own. However, the general steps are as follows:
1. Disconnect the Power
The first step is to unplug your AeroGarden from the power source. This ensures that the system is completely shut down and prevents any damage during the reset process.
2. Remove the Seed Pods and Plants (Optional)
While not strictly necessary, removing the seed pods and plants can help to clean the system more thoroughly. If you’re starting a new garden, this step is highly recommended.
3. Clean the Reservoir and Pump
Use a mild cleaning solution and a soft cloth to clean the inside of the reservoir. Be sure to also clean the pump and any other components that come into contact with the water. Rinsing with clean water is important to remove any cleaning solution residue.
4. Refill the Reservoir with Fresh Water
Once the reservoir is clean, refill it with fresh, filtered water. Refer to your AeroGarden’s manual for the recommended water level.
5. Add Nutrient Solution (If Applicable)
Most AeroGarden models require the addition of a nutrient solution to provide the plants with the necessary nutrients for growth. Follow the instructions on your nutrient solution bottle for the correct amount to add to the reservoir.
6. Reconnect the Power
Plug your AeroGarden back into the power source. The system should power on automatically.
7. Reset the Timer (If Necessary)
Some AeroGarden models have a built-in timer that needs to be reset after the device is unplugged. Consult your AeroGarden’s manual for instructions on resetting the timer.
Troubleshooting Tips
If you’re still having trouble with your AeroGarden after resetting it, here are a few troubleshooting tips:
- Check the power cord and outlet: Make sure that the power cord is properly plugged in and that the outlet is working. Try plugging your AeroGarden into a different outlet.
- Check the water level: Ensure that the water level in the reservoir is at the correct level. Too much or too little water can affect the performance of your AeroGarden.
- Check the nutrient solution: Make sure that you’re using the correct nutrient solution for your plants and that it’s not expired.
- Check the lights: Make sure that the grow lights are turned on and that they’re working properly. If the lights are too dim, your plants may not grow as well.
